Atkins Companies Completes Capital Improvements at West Orange Medical Office Building

Investments into the 120,000-square-foot building create a modern healthcare destination

West Orange, N.J. (October 25, 2022)Atkins Companies announces the completion of capital improvements at its 120,000-square-foot Atkins Kent 101 medical office building located at 101 Old Short Hills Road in West Orange, N.J.

Located directly across the street from Cooperman Barnabas Medical Center and adjacent to RWJBarnabas Health’s corporate offices in West Orange, Atkins Kent 101 is one of the area’s premier healthcare facilities serving the needs of private practitioners as well as large regional healthcare systems. Constructed in 1983 by Atkins Companies, the building features three stretcher-accessible elevators, ample patient parking with an abundance of handicapped spaces, automatic doors, canopied entries for patient drop-off, and a modern design featuring a two-story lobby with granite flooring. The building’s timeless design, paired with Atkins Companies’ hands-on management and proactive capital investments, has continually cemented its role as an invaluable piece of the local area’s healthcare landscape over the last four decades. 

Aiming to build upon its legacy of strategic investments into Atkins Kent 101, the capital improvement project sought to enhance patients’ and practitioners’ experience at the building. The improvements include the renovation and modernization of the building’s common areas and restrooms on the second, fourth and fifth floors through the addition of new lighting, flooring, fixtures and decor.
